Iodobenzene-d5
Iodobenzene-d5 is the deuterium labeled 1-Iodobenzene. Iodobenzene can undergo Ullmann coupling reaction on copper catalyst to generate biphenyl. Iodobenzene can undergo Suzuki reaction with phenylboronic acid to generate biphenyl[1][2].
